My steps:
- launched MM - filemonitor is set to run at startup
- clicked on music node while filemonitor running and selected an album, en vogue/funky divas with poor quality artwork
- clicked on the art & details viewer, and selected Edit Artwork properties
- deleted artwork for the album
- said yes to the are you sure prompts
- after clicking yes, the file monitor process ("monitoring xxxx of xxxx") stopped running
